Hands and Feet

Scripture: Joshua 6 Key Verse: 6:20
"So the troops shouted very loudly when they heard the blast of the rams' horns, and the wall collapsed. The troops charged straight ahead and captured the city."

Objective:
This is the story of the fall of Jericho. God had promised the city to the Israelites. The Jerichoites feared the the Israelites. The Israelites were commanded to walk around the city once a day for six days, and seven times on the seventh. After the seventh time the priests would blow the seven horns and the armed men would shout. This is what brought the walls of Jericho down.
